Penn Yan police investigated a motor vehicle-pedestrian accident on Liberty Street in from of St. Michael’s Church at 5:01 pm on Saturday. The investigation revealed that the victim, Karen Pulver stepped out into the path of a northbound vehicle operated by Shane McMinn of Penn Yan.Pulver was transported by ambulance to Strong Memorial Hospital for her injuries.On Monday, it was learned that Pulver is still hospitalized at Strong Memorial for treatment of a broken pelvis and head injuries and is listed in satisfactory condition.No tickets have been issued and the accident remains under investigation.
